Packers Eye Draft to Fill Departed Roster Holes

The Packers enter the 2024 NFL Draft with a solid foundation and several key areas to address. After a surprising run in the playoffs, the team aims to bolster its roster to challenge for a championship. With the departure of longtime tackle David Bakhtiari, the Packers will likely prioritize adding depth at the position. Safety is another area of need, as Darnell Savage and Jonathan Owens have moved on. The Packers have a strong draft position, with three picks in the first two rounds and five in the top 100. They will have the first selection at 25th overall.
